AND INTO THE STREETS (queer art installation)
Join us for the opening of AND INTO THE STREETS, a new public art project by artist Rami George that celebrates Philly’s queer cultural memory. This temporary public art project represents archival images and materials from the now-defunct LGBTQ new publication, Au Courant (1982-2000).
